Explore basic prompt techniques, including zero short prompting, to elicit effective AI outputs from simple questions without prior context, such as explaining the Pythagoras theorem to a 10th grade class.
Explore few-shot prompting, a technique that guides AI responses by embedding example conversations and formats in the prompt, enabling structured teacher–student interactions.
Use role-playing prompting by assigning a specific role or persona to the AI, focusing on a single task for more accurate outputs, and tailor explanations for students.
Avoid common mistakes by crafting specific prompts, narrowing focus, and breaking tasks into manageable parts; set clear context with grade level, subject, and tone to guide AI output.
